Caring for a Grey Parrot: A Comprehensive Guide
Grey parrots, particularly the African Grey, are renowned for their remarkable intelligence and exceptional ability to simulate human speech. As fascinating buddies, they need specific care to prosper physically and psychologically. This short article acts as an extensive guide to understanding and nurturing a grey parrot, covering various elements such as dietary requirements, social interaction, environmental requirements, and health considerations.

Understanding the African Grey Parrot
The African Grey Parrot is a medium-sized bird originating from the rainforests of West and Central Africa. With striking grey plumes, intense red tails, and a strong beak, they are both stunning and interesting. Table 1: Key Characteristics of African Grey Parrots
| Characteristic | Description |
|---|---|
| Size | 12-14 inches (30-35 cm) |
| Weight | 12-20 ounces (340-570 grams) |
| Lifespan | 50-70 years |
| Color | Grey feathers, red tail, distinctive beak |
| Diet | Seeds, nuts, fruits, veggies |
| Vocalization | Highly singing with the ability to mimic |
Dietary Needs

1. Pellets
- High-quality pellets should comprise a considerable part of their diet. These are developed to satisfy the dietary requirements of grey parrots.
2. Fresh Fruits and Vegetables
- Daily portions of fresh fruits and vegetables are vital. Some advised choices include:
- Apples (without seeds)
- Carrots
- Leafy greens (kale, spinach)
- Bell peppers
- Berries
3. Nuts and Seeds
- While nuts can be a healthy treat, they need to be provided in moderation due to their high-fat material. Pumpkin seeds, almonds, and walnuts are excellent choices.
4. Water
- Fresh, clean water must be available at all times. Modification the water everyday to ensure its tidiness.
Table 2: Sample Daily Diet for a Grey Parrot
| Time of Day | Food Type | Recommendations |
|---|---|---|
| Morning | Pellets | 1/4 to 1/2 cup of premium pellets |
| Midday | Fruits | 1/4 cup of sliced fruits |
| Afternoon | Vegetables | 1/4 cup of assorted fresh veggies |
| Evening | Nuts | 1-2 nuts for a treat |
| All the time | Water | Fresh water, changed daily |
Social Interaction and Mental Stimulation
Grey parrots are highly social creatures that flourish on interaction with their owners. Understanding their social requirements is paramount to their mental health.
1. Daily Interaction
- Invest time talking, singing, and having fun with your grey parrot. Goal for a minimum of 1-2 hours of active interaction daily.
2. Toys and Enrichment
- Offer a range of toys to keep them psychologically promoted. Turn toys regularly to avoid boredom and encourage expedition.
- Advised toys include:
- Chew toys (wood and paper)
- Foraging toys
- Interactive puzzles
3. Training
- Taking part in regular training sessions can help improve their cognitive capabilities and reinforce the bond in between the parrot and the owner.
- Use positive reinforcement methods, such as treats and appreciation, to encourage desired habits.
Ecological Needs
Developing a suitable environment for a grey parrot is vital for their well-being. Here are crucial factors to consider:
1. Cage Size
- The cage should be roomy enough for the parrot to walk around comfortably. A minimum size of 24" x 24" x 36" is advised, however bigger is constantly better.
2. Perches and Accessories
- Provide several perches of varying thickness to promote foot health. Consist of natural wood sets down for grip.
- Ensure the cage has toys, food and water meals, and a safe and secure place for resting.
3. Temperature and Light
- Grey parrots feel comfortable in temperatures in between 65 ° F and 80 ° F (18 ° C to 27 ° C). Avoid putting their cage in draughty areas.
- Natural light is vital; if sunshine is inadequate, think about full-spectrum lighting to imitate natural conditions.
Health Considerations
To make sure a long, healthy life for your grey parrot, routine veterinary care and proper health tracking are important.
1. Regular Vet Check-ups
- Schedule yearly check-ups with an avian veterinarian to monitor your bird's health and get vaccinations when essential.
2. Expect Signs of Illness
- Be mindful to changes in behavior, such as decreased vocalization, loss of plumes, modifications in cravings, or lethargy, as they might suggest health issue.
FAQs about Caring for Grey Parrots
Q: How often should I clean my grey parrot's cage?
A: The cage ought to be cleaned daily, getting rid of food particles and waste. A deep tidy should happen weekly.
Q: Do grey parrots require a companion?
A: While grey parrots can love enough interaction from their owners, they are social birds and may benefit from a buddy bird. Nevertheless, they can bond deeply with their human caretakers.
Q: Can African Grey Parrots be let outside?
A: Yes, supervised outdoor time can be beneficial, however make sure safety from predators and keep a close watch. Their wings should be cut if they are not flight-trained.
Q: How can I prevent my grey parrot from ending up being tired?
A: Regularly rotate toys, introduce new video games, and vary interaction-- attempt different training workouts or activities to keep them engaged mentally.
